In the ever-evolving landscape of digital finance, cryptocurrency has emerged as a revolutionary force, reshaping how we perceive and engage with money. At the heart of this transformation lies a complex network of systems and technologies, among which cryptocurrency nodes play a pivotal role. As we delve into the intricacies of cryptocurrency nodes, we will uncover their significance, functionality, and the impact they have on the broader blockchain ecosystem.
Understanding these components is essential for anyone looking to navigate the world of cryptocurrencies effectively. Cryptocurrency nodes serve as the backbone of decentralized networks, ensuring that transactions are processed, verified, and recorded in a secure manner. As we explore this topic, we will not only define what nodes are but also examine their operational mechanics and the various types that exist.
By gaining insight into these elements, we can appreciate the critical role nodes play in maintaining the integrity and efficiency of blockchain technology.
Key Takeaways
- Cryptocurrency nodes are essential components of a blockchain network, serving as the backbone of the decentralized system.
- Cryptocurrency nodes are essentially computers that are connected to the blockchain network and play a crucial role in validating and relaying transactions.
- Cryptocurrency nodes work by constantly communicating with other nodes in the network to ensure that all transactions are valid and consistent with the rules of the blockchain.
- The role of cryptocurrency nodes in the blockchain is to maintain the integrity and security of the network by validating transactions and blocks, as well as relaying information to other nodes.
- There are different types of cryptocurrency nodes, including full nodes, light nodes, and mining nodes, each serving different functions within the blockchain network.
What Are Cryptocurrency Nodes?
Ensuring Network Security and Reliability
By storing this information, nodes contribute to the overall security and reliability of the network. They ensure that every transaction is validated and that no fraudulent activities can take place without detection.
Types of Nodes
Nodes can be categorized into different types based on their functions and responsibilities within the network. Some nodes are full nodes, which maintain a complete copy of the blockchain and validate transactions independently.
Varying Levels of Commitment and Resource Requirements
Others may be lightweight or SPV (Simplified Payment Verification) nodes, which do not store the entire blockchain but still participate in the network by verifying transactions through other full nodes. This distinction is crucial as it highlights the varying levels of commitment and resource requirements associated with running different types of nodes.
How Cryptocurrency Nodes Work

The operation of cryptocurrency nodes is rooted in a consensus mechanism that allows them to agree on the state of the blockchain. When a new transaction is initiated, it is broadcasted to the network, where nodes receive and validate it against existing records. This validation process involves checking whether the sender has sufficient funds and whether the transaction adheres to the network’s rules.
Once verified, the transaction is added to a block, which is then appended to the blockchain. Nodes communicate with one another to propagate transactions and blocks throughout the network. This decentralized communication ensures that all participants have access to the same information, thereby enhancing transparency and trust.
Additionally, nodes work collaboratively to reach consensus on which blocks should be added to the blockchain, preventing any single entity from exerting control over the network. This collaborative effort is what makes cryptocurrencies resilient against censorship and fraud.
The Role of Cryptocurrency Nodes in the Blockchain
Cryptocurrency nodes are integral to maintaining the decentralized nature of blockchain technology. By distributing copies of the blockchain across numerous nodes, we create a system that is resistant to tampering and centralized control. Each node acts as an independent verifier, ensuring that all transactions are legitimate and that no single point of failure exists within the network.
Moreover, nodes play a crucial role in enhancing the security of the blockchain. The more nodes that participate in a network, the more difficult it becomes for malicious actors to manipulate or attack it. This decentralized architecture not only protects against fraud but also fosters trust among users who rely on the integrity of the system for their financial transactions.
In essence, cryptocurrency nodes are not just passive participants; they are active guardians of the blockchain’s security and functionality.
Types of Cryptocurrency Nodes
As we explore the various types of cryptocurrency nodes, we find that each serves a unique purpose within the ecosystem. Full nodes are perhaps the most well-known type; they download and store a complete copy of the blockchain, validating all transactions independently. This type of node requires significant storage space and computational power but offers maximum security and reliability.
On the other hand, lightweight or SPV nodes provide a more accessible option for users who may not have the resources to run a full node. These nodes do not store the entire blockchain but instead rely on full nodes for transaction verification. While they are less secure than full nodes, they still contribute to network functionality by allowing users to send and receive transactions without needing extensive hardware or bandwidth.
Another category worth mentioning is mining nodes, which are responsible for creating new blocks by solving complex mathematical problems. These nodes play a critical role in proof-of-work systems, where miners compete to validate transactions and earn rewards in the form of cryptocurrency. Each type of node contributes to the overall health and efficiency of the network, highlighting the diversity within cryptocurrency ecosystems.
Setting Up and Running a Cryptocurrency Node

Setting up a cryptocurrency node can be an exciting venture for those interested in participating actively in blockchain networks. The process typically begins with selecting a cryptocurrency for which we want to run a node. Each cryptocurrency has its own requirements regarding hardware specifications, software installation, and network configuration.
Once we have chosen our cryptocurrency, we need to ensure that our hardware meets its requirements. Full nodes often require substantial storage capacity and processing power, while lightweight nodes can operate on less powerful devices. After preparing our hardware, we can download the necessary software from official sources and follow installation instructions carefully.
It’s essential to keep our software updated to ensure compatibility with network changes and improvements. After installation, we must connect our node to the network by syncing it with existing blockchain data. This process can take time, especially for full nodes that need to download extensive historical data.
Once synced, our node will begin validating transactions and contributing to network security. Regular maintenance is also crucial; monitoring performance and ensuring uptime helps keep our node functioning optimally.
Benefits and Risks of Running a Cryptocurrency Node
Running a cryptocurrency node comes with its own set of benefits and risks that we must consider before diving into this endeavor. One significant advantage is that by operating a node, we contribute directly to the decentralization and security of the network. This participation fosters trust among users and enhances our understanding of how cryptocurrencies function.
Additionally, running a full node can provide us with greater privacy since we do not need to rely on third-party services for transaction verification. We also gain access to real-time data about transactions occurring on the network, allowing us to stay informed about market trends and developments. However, there are risks associated with running a node as well.
The initial setup can require significant investment in hardware and ongoing costs related to electricity and internet connectivity. Moreover, maintaining a node demands technical knowledge; troubleshooting issues may be necessary if problems arise during operation. Additionally, while running a node enhances our privacy, it does not guarantee complete anonymity; we must still be cautious about how we manage our personal information.
The Future of Cryptocurrency Nodes
As we look ahead to the future of cryptocurrency nodes, it is clear that they will continue to play an essential role in shaping decentralized finance. With increasing interest in cryptocurrencies from both individuals and institutions, we can expect advancements in node technology that enhance efficiency and accessibility. Innovations such as improved consensus mechanisms or more user-friendly interfaces may lower barriers for new participants looking to run their own nodes.
Furthermore, as regulatory frameworks around cryptocurrencies evolve, we may see changes in how nodes operate within different jurisdictions. Compliance with regulations could lead to new standards for node operation, impacting how decentralized networks function globally. However, this evolution must balance regulatory oversight with preserving the core principles of decentralization that underpin cryptocurrencies.
In conclusion, cryptocurrency nodes are fundamental components of blockchain technology that ensure security, transparency, and decentralization within digital finance ecosystems. As we continue to explore this dynamic field, understanding nodes’ roles will empower us to engage more effectively with cryptocurrencies while contributing to their growth and sustainability in an increasingly digital world.
FAQs
What is a cryptocurrency node?
A cryptocurrency node is a computer that participates in the network of a specific cryptocurrency by validating and relaying transactions, as well as maintaining a copy of the blockchain.
How does a cryptocurrency node work?
Cryptocurrency nodes work by communicating with other nodes in the network to validate and relay transactions, as well as to maintain a copy of the blockchain. They also play a role in reaching consensus on the state of the network.
What is the role of a cryptocurrency node in the network?
The role of a cryptocurrency node in the network is to validate and relay transactions, maintain a copy of the blockchain, and participate in reaching consensus on the state of the network.
What are the different types of cryptocurrency nodes?
There are different types of cryptocurrency nodes, including full nodes, light nodes, and mining nodes. Full nodes store a complete copy of the blockchain, while light nodes only store a portion of the blockchain. Mining nodes are responsible for creating new blocks in the blockchain.
How can one set up a cryptocurrency node?
Setting up a cryptocurrency node typically involves downloading the necessary software for the specific cryptocurrency, syncing the node with the network, and ensuring that the node has the required hardware and internet connection to function effectively.